Morgan SLR (Spritzel Lawrencetune Racing)

Seen at Silverstone Classic Weekend, when I took the photo I thought I would get home to find this was an exotic Italian, the #64 was not in the programme, however after referring to Anthony Pritchards Directory of Classic Prototypes and Grand Touring Cars I was surprised to find this is in fact one of four SLR Morgan's. Looking at the programme I am wondering if this is the car listed as #67 driven by John Emberson and and Bill Wykeham ?
Would be gratefull if someone could confirm this :-)

It is.
There are actually 3 Morgan SLRs
Silver- John Embersons's
Red- Simon Orebi-Gann's- also racing at Silverstone Classic
Green-Keith Alher's

the other car is based on Triumph mechanicals with similar bodywork so is not a Morgan.
